lhj200304 发表于 2012-4-20 00:08

microchip的AN1078的调整,一进入闭环就停下来,是什么原因

本帖最后由 lhj200304 于 2012-4-20 00:09 编辑

最近搞了一个DM330023的开发套件在调试,碰到了很多问题,在电机方面是个新手,各位大侠多多出手指教
各个信号如图所示

lhj200304 发表于 2012-4-20 00:10

求救,重复上传的那些照片怎么删除掉

lhj200304 发表于 2012-4-23 09:04

没有人在做microchip的无传感器BLAC方案吗?是不是他们的不好用呀

lhj200304 发表于 2012-5-6 13:10

要这个月14号才能排队见到FAE,又折腾了一下发现,主要原因是转速变为负值了,所以为了保护,就停下来重新启动,为什么会变负值呢,
if (smc1.OmegaFltred < 0)
{
//uGF.bit.RunMotor = 0;
}    要在哪方面调整呢,哪位大侠指点一下。谢了

lhj200304 发表于 2012-5-6 13:11

我把停止的代码注释掉,再发波形上来

stormwind 发表于 2012-5-7 11:09

转速不太稳定,可以调整一下滑模参数

stormwind 发表于 2012-5-7 13:19

一进转速闭环就停下的话,可能是转速控制器的输出太小,导致转速迅速下降,加上转速检测的问题,所以出现负转速

lhj200304 发表于 2012-5-7 13:49

本帖最后由 lhj200304 于 2012-5-7 13:55 编辑

回复 7# stormwind


    现在是在力矩模式下,去掉速度环的情况,在试,效果差不多

stormwind 发表于 2012-5-7 16:24

你的意思是进入转矩闭环就会停下?前面这些图是在电压开环测试的结果?能看id,iq的状态吗

lhj200304 发表于 2012-5-8 16:03

是的,上面的是电压开环的状态,我再看看怎么才能看到id。iq

lhj200304 发表于 2012-5-8 19:33


上面是d轴和q轴电流

lhj200304 发表于 2012-5-8 20:31

PI参数改小10倍以后是这个样子的

stormwind 发表于 2012-5-9 11:04

Id,Iq也不是很稳定,估计位置检测还是有问题。建议你电压开环时使用一个旋转的给定角度,然后将估算角度与给定角度相比较,再调整滑模参数使估算角度尽可能接近给定角度。

lhj200304 发表于 2012-5-10 20:51

现在增大I的值后情况好了些,不过还是先正转,然后倒转,然后停下来,在一个位置抖动,其他参数还在观察

lhj200304 发表于 2012-5-10 20:53

iQId的情况如下

xiaolinfa1987 发表于 2012-5-11 08:40

没有调过这个板子。看了一下文档。请问开始的锁定阶段是怎么处理的,是发一个固定角度吗?会不会反转?
从开环切到闭环的判断速度是怎么选取的?

lhj200304 发表于 2012-5-11 10:36

现在示波器太烂了,看不到锁定的那个过程,锁定就是先给两相通电,让电机转到一个位置,开环到闭环没做速度方面的判断

lhj200304 发表于 2012-5-12 14:49

在开环到闭环切换的过程中有一个错位,应该是位置检测没做好,导致的反转

lhj200304 发表于 2012-5-12 14:50

在开环到闭环切换的过程中有一个错位,应该是位置检测没做好,导致的反转

lhj200304 发表于 2012-5-12 15:01

刚才格式不对。修改后上传
页: [1] 2
查看完整版本: microchip的AN1078的调整,一进入闭环就停下来,是什么原因